Ford Everest Sport Officially Launched, with a Promo Price

Ford Everest Sport has officially launched in Indonesia with a range of appealing features, including promotional pricing during the launch period.

KatadataOTO – RMA Indonesia, as the official distributor of Ford, has officially launched their newest product, the Everest Sport. This car comes with various attractive advantages that are believed to meet the needs of drivers in the country.

This car is equipped with various advantages to attract customer interest. From its bold design to the inclusion of various features to enhance driving comfort.

"We are confident that the combination of a sporty design, complete features, and a powerful engine can make the Next-Gen Ford Everest Sport a top choice in its class." Toto Suharto, Country Manager of Ford RMA Indonesia (12/04).

On the exterior, its appearance is bold thanks to black accents on the grille, door handles, roof rails, and door mirrors. The distinctive C-Clamp design on the LED Headlamps is equipped with DRLs. Moving to the side, the car is equipped with 20-inch alloy wheels, making it more attractive.

Entering the cabin, the Ford Everest Sport is designed to meet the comfort needs of a family. The cabin feels spacious with a 7-seat configuration wrapped in black leather material.

Interestingly, the driver and front passenger seats are equipped with 8-way power seat adjustment.  Thanks to this, a comfortable seating position is easier to achieve.

As for its powertrain, the car is equipped with a 2.0L Turbo diesel engine 4x2 6AT to produce 170 hp with 405 Nm of torque. This power is channeled to the wheels through a 6-speed SelectShift™ automatic transmission to ensure smooth and efficient gear shifts.

The car is equipped with Selectable Drive Modes (Normal, Eco, Tow/Haul, Slippery). Thanks to this, the driver can adjust their driving style according to their needs.

Various safety features have also been included to ensure the driver can control it more easily. Starting from the Anti-Lock Braking System (ABS), Electronic Brake Force Distribution (EBD), Brake Assist (BA), Electronic Stability Control (ESC), to the Traction Control System (TCS).

When facing steep inclines, the driver can utilize Hill Launch Assist (HLA) to prevent the car from rolling backward. Rollover Mitigation and Adaptive Load Control are also available to maintain stability when carrying heavy loads.

The Ford Everest Sport is sold for Rp 799 million OTR Jakarta. However, specifically for purchases during the exhibition, RMA is offering a special price of Rp 789 million.
